Transaction 73236bec2d7e3adcd60f821595149f80e8e952fdb02075fe1f4aa9a55d877653

1 Input
2 Outputs
  • 73236bec2d7e3adcd60f821595149f80e8e952fdb02075fe1f4aa9a55d877653:0
  • value  1200000
    address  1EFLPXS9rr4yxTPK9wopXm9zJXxP4yxT6F
  • 73236bec2d7e3adcd60f821595149f80e8e952fdb02075fe1f4aa9a55d877653:1
  • value  67055943
    address  16wpWooCHbBxTDeUCS44xXpxrZgiKyz6xH